Output d6ad06731d13194ea86026e9a598bd2975a2e136d9ad872b554145f524d8a81f:3

value
26730000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e369b35b1442d4cbc0d51922350a5c9a9c06d01 OP_EQUALVERIFY OP_CHECKSIG
address
15DMVwGP9jivd68cxQnkCy71EjxhEHFco8
transaction
d6ad06731d13194ea86026e9a598bd2975a2e136d9ad872b554145f524d8a81f
spent
true